diff options
| author | Lu Qiuwen <[email protected]> | 2018-11-12 10:39:47 +0800 |
|---|---|---|
| committer | Lu Qiuwen <[email protected]> | 2018-11-12 11:09:22 +0800 |
| commit | db690f4503a706f816f213d1c65f147166789a7a (patch) | |
| tree | 09bd3c65c96a50b04cdfb6f027178f8d1208fc8c | |
| parent | 63e0af0f8d11f44c98e6f3da5411ffb0dffafe90 (diff) | |
增加GitLab CI配置文件
| -rw-r--r-- | .gitlab-ci.yml | 20 |
1 files changed, 20 insertions, 0 deletions
di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ml new file mode 100644 index 0000000..3540700 --- /dev/null +++ b/.gitlab-ci.yml @@ -0,0 +1,20 @@ +image: centos:7.4.1708 +before_script: + - yum update -y + - yum install -y "kernel-devel-uname-r == $(uname -r)" + - yum install -y gcc gcc-c++ libpcap-devel epel-release wget -y + - yum install -y python2-pip + - pip install --upgrade pip + - pip install PyInstaller + - pip install PrettyTable + - wget https://cmake.org/files/v3.12/cmake-3.12.4.tar.gz -O /tmp/cmake-3.12.4.tar.gz + - cd /tmp/; tar xf cmake-3.12.4.tar.gz; cd cmake-3.12.4; ./bootstrap + +build: + stage: build + tags: + - mrzcpd + - package-builder + - centos-7.4.1708 + script: + - docker info |
